181. 
When a proud man hears another praised, he feels himself injured.
182. 
Who seeks more than he needs hinders himself from enjoying what he has.
183. 
The hunter does not rub himself in oil and lie by the fire to sleep.
184. 
The lizard that jumped from the high iroko tree said he would praise himself if no one else did.
185. 
If the thunder is not loud, the peasant forgets to cross himself.
186. 
The peasant will not cross himself before it begins to thunder.
187. 
He that falls by himself never cries.
188. 
Every one for himself, and God for us all.
